Development of Orthodontic Techniques



For many years, orthodontic strategies have actually developed dramatically to give more reliable and effective methods of straightening teeth. Today, orthodontists have a variety of tools and approaches at their disposal to assist you achieve an attractive and healthy smile. One significant improvement has actually been the development of clear aligners, such as Invisalign, which supply an even more very discreet choice to standard dental braces. These aligners are tailor-made for your teeth and can be easily gotten rid of for eating and cleaning.

Another development in orthodontics is the use of 3D imaging technology to produce accurate treatment strategies. This technology permits orthodontists to picture the movement of your teeth and predict the final end result of your treatment a lot more accurately. Furthermore, advancements in materials have actually resulted in the production of smaller sized, a lot more comfortable braces that are less obvious and much more reliable in moving teeth right into the preferred setting.

Mechanics of Tooth Movement



Comprehending exactly how teeth move throughout orthodontic treatment is crucial for both orthodontists and people to grasp the mechanics of tooth movement. When stress is applied to a tooth, it initiates a procedure referred to as bone improvement. This procedure involves the breakdown and restoring of bone cells to allow the tooth to relocate into its right position. The pressure applied by dental braces or aligners triggers a waterfall of events within the gum tendon, leading to the repositioning of the tooth.

Tooth motion occurs in feedback to the force applied and the body's all-natural response to that force. As the tooth relocations, bone is resorbed on one side and deposited on the various other. This continual cycle of bone improvement enables the tooth to shift progressively over time. Orthodontists meticulously plan the direction and amount of pressure required to achieve the preferred motion, thinking about elements such as tooth root length and bone density.
